hlmod.hu
https://hlmod.hu/

C4Plugin run time error
https://hlmod.hu/viewtopic.php?f=9&t=5217
Oldal: 1 / 1

Szerző:  Bence98007 [2012.07.11. 20:22 ]
Hozzászólás témája:  C4Plugin run time error

Üdv.!

Valaki megnézé ezt nekem hogy ezmiez???

0:18:23 L 07/11/2012 - 20:17:31: Function "logevent_round_start" was not found
20:18:23 L 07/11/2012 - 20:17:31: [AMXX] Displaying debug trace (plugin "C4Plugin.amxx")
20:18:23 L 07/11/2012 - 20:17:31: [AMXX] Run time error 19: function not found
20:18:23 L 07/11/2012 - 20:17:31: [AMXX] [0] 2995168.sma::plugin_init (line 18)



Kód:
  1. #include <amxmodx>  

  2. #include <cstrike>

  3. #include <csx>

  4. #include <dhudmessage>  

  5.  

  6. new const PLUGIN[] = "C4 Plugin"  

  7. new const VERSION[] = "1.1b"  

  8. new const AUTHOR[] = "Xvil"  

  9.  

  10. new g_Cvar, g_C4

  11.  

  12.  

  13. public plugin_init() {  

  14.     register_plugin(PLUGIN, VERSION, AUTHOR)  

  15.     g_C4 = get_cvar_pointer("mp_c4timer")

  16.     g_Cvar = register_cvar("bm_enabled", "1")

  17.     register_logevent("RoundEnd",2,"1=Round_End")    

  18.     register_logevent("logevent_round_start", 2, "1=Round_Start")    

  19.      

  20. }  

  21.  

  22. public plugin_precache() {

  23.         precache_sound("misc/tiz.wav")  

  24.         precache_sound("misc/kilenc.wav")  

  25.         precache_sound("misc/nyolc.wav")  

  26.         precache_sound("misc/het.wav")  

  27.         precache_sound("misc/hat.wav")  

  28.         precache_sound("misc/ot.wav")  

  29.         precache_sound("misc/negy.wav")  

  30.         precache_sound("misc/harom.wav")  

  31.         precache_sound("misc/ketto.wav")  

  32.         precache_sound("misc/egy.wav")  

  33.         precache_sound("radio/bot/terwin.wav")  

  34.         precache_sound("radio/bot/defusing_bomb.wav")  

  35.         precache_sound("radio/bot/im_gonna_go_plant.wav")  

  36.         precache_sound("radio/bot/im_gonna_go_plant_the_bomb.wav")  

  37.         precache_sound("radio/bot/defusing.wav")  

  38.         precache_sound("radio/bot/defusing_bomb_now.wav")  

  39.         precache_sound("radio/bot/ctwin.wav")  

  40.         precache_sound("radio/bot/good_one_sir2.wav")  

  41.      

  42.         return PLUGIN_HANDLED  

  43. }  

  44.  

  45. public bomb_planting(planter) {  

  46.      

  47.     new PLname[32]  

  48.     new randim = random_num(0,1)  

  49.      

  50.     if(!get_pcvar_num(g_Cvar))  

  51.         return PLUGIN_CONTINUE  

  52.          

  53.     get_user_name(planter, PLname, 31)  

  54.     set_dhudmessage( 173, 255, 47, 0.35, 0.03, 0, 6.0, 3.0, 0.1, 1.5 )

  55.     show_dhudmessage(0, "%s elesiti a Bombat...", PLname)

  56.      

  57.     switch(randim)  

  58.   {  

  59.     case 0: client_cmd(0,"spk radio/bot/im_gonna_go_plant_the_bomb.wav")  

  60.     case 1: client_cmd(0,"spk radio/bot/im_gonna_go_plant.wav")  

  61.   }  

  62.      

  63.     return PLUGIN_HANDLED  

  64.      

  65. }  

  66.  

  67. public bomb_planted(planter) {  

  68.     new Name[32]

  69.      

  70.     if(!get_pcvar_num(g_Cvar))  

  71.         return PLUGIN_CONTINUE  

  72.          

  73.     get_user_name(planter, Name, 31)  

  74.    

  75.     set_dhudmessage( 0, 255, 127, 0.35, 0.03, 0, 6.0, 3.0, 0.1, 1.5 )

  76.     show_dhudmessage(0, "%s elesitette a bombat !", Name)  

  77.    

  78.    

  79.      

  80.      

  81.     new time = get_pcvar_num(g_C4)

  82.    

  83.     float(time)

  84.    

  85.      

  86.     set_task( (time - 10.0) , "Zero", 0)       

  87.     set_task( (time - 9.0) , "one", 0)  

  88.     set_task( (time - 8.0) , "two", 0)  

  89.     set_task( (time - 7.0) , "three", 0)  

  90.     set_task( (time - 6.0) , "foor", 0)  

  91.     set_task( (time - 5.0) , "five", 0)  

  92.     set_task( (time - 4.0) , "six", 0);

  93.     set_task( (time - 3.0) , "seven", 0)  

  94.     set_task( (time - 2.0) , "eigth", 0)  

  95.     set_task( (time - 1.0) , "nine", 0)  

  96.     return PLUGIN_CONTINUE  

  97. }  

  98.  

  99. public Zero()  

  100. {  

  101.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  102.     show_hudmessage(0, "Robbanas 10 masodperc mulva...")  

  103.     client_cmd(0, "spk misc/ten.wav" )  

  104.     return PLUGIN_CONTINUE  

  105. }  

  106.  

  107. public one()  

  108. {  

  109.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  110.     show_hudmessage(0, "Robbanas 9 masodperc mulva...")  

  111.     client_cmd(0, "spk misc/kilenc.wav" )  

  112.     return PLUGIN_CONTINUE  

  113. }  

  114. public two()  

  115. {  

  116.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  117.     show_hudmessage(0, "Robbanas 8 masodperc mulva...")  

  118.     client_cmd(0, "spk misc/nyolc.wav")  

  119.     return PLUGIN_CONTINUE  

  120. }  

  121. public three()  

  122. {  

  123.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  124.     show_hudmessage(0, "Robbanas 7 masodperc mulva...")  

  125.     client_cmd(0, "spk misc/het.wav")  

  126.     return PLUGIN_CONTINUE  

  127. }  

  128. public foor()  

  129. {  

  130.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  131.     show_hudmessage(0, "Robbanas 6 masodperc mulva...")  

  132.     client_cmd(0, "spk misc/hat.wav"  )  

  133.     return PLUGIN_CONTINUE  

  134. }  

  135. public five()  

  136. {  

  137.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  138.     show_hudmessage(0, "Robbanas 5 masodperc mulva...")  

  139.     client_cmd(0, "spk misc/ot.wav" )  

  140.     return PLUGIN_CONTINUE  

  141. }  

  142. public six()  

  143. {  

  144.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  145.     show_hudmessage(0, "Robbanas 4 masodperc mulva...")  

  146.     client_cmd(0, "spk misc/negy.wav" )  

  147.     return PLUGIN_CONTINUE  

  148. }  

  149. public seven()  

  150. {  

  151.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  152.     show_hudmessage(0, "Robbanas 3 masodperc mulva...")  

  153.     client_cmd(0, "spk misc/harom.wav")  

  154.     return PLUGIN_CONTINUE  

  155. }  

  156. public eigth()  

  157. {  

  158.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  159.     show_hudmessage(0, "Robbanas 2 masodperc mulva..")  

  160.     client_cmd(0, "spk misc/ketto.wav"  )  

  161.     return PLUGIN_CONTINUE  

  162. }  

  163. public nine()  

  164. {  

  165.     set_hudmessage(77, 77, 255, -1.0, 0.17, 0, 0.9, 1.0)  

  166.     show_hudmessage(0, "Robbanas 1 masodperc mulva.")  

  167.     client_cmd(0, "spk misc/egy.wav")  

  168.     return PLUGIN_CONTINUE  

  169. }  

  170.  

  171. public bomb_explode(planter, defuser) {  

  172.     new PName[32]  

  173.     new randam = random_num(0,2)  

  174.      

  175.     if(!get_pcvar_num(g_Cvar))  

  176.         return PLUGIN_CONTINUE  

  177.          

  178.     remove_task(0,0)  

  179.      

  180.     get_user_name(planter, PName, 31)  

  181.     set_dhudmessage( 219, 219, 112, 0.35, 0.03, 0, 6.0, 3.0, 0.1, 1.5 )

  182.     show_dhudmessage(0, "A Bomba felrobbant! Szep munka %s", PName)  

  183.     switch(randam)  

  184.   {  

  185.     case 0: client_cmd(0,"spk radio/bot/good_one_sir2.wav")  

  186.     case 1: client_cmd(0,"spk radio/bot/terwin.wav")  

  187.   }  

  188.      

  189.     return PLUGIN_HANDLED  

  190. }  

  191.  

  192. public bomb_defusing(defuser) {  

  193.     new DName[32];  

  194.     new rando = random_num(0,2)  

  195.      

  196.     if(!get_pcvar_num(g_Cvar))  

  197.         return PLUGIN_CONTINUE  

  198.      

  199.     get_user_name(defuser, DName, 31)  

  200.     set_dhudmessage( 219, 219, 112, 0.35, 0.03, 0, 6.0, 3.0, 0.1, 1.5 )  

  201.     show_dhudmessage(0, "%s megprobalja hatastalanitani a bombat...", DName)  

  202.     switch(rando)  

  203.   {  

  204.     case 0: client_cmd(0,"spk radio/bot/defusing_bomb.wav")  

  205.     case 1: client_cmd(0,"spk radio/bot/defusing.wav")  

  206.     case 2: client_cmd(0,"spk radio/bot/defusing_bomb_now.wav")  

  207.   }  

  208.     return PLUGIN_CONTINUE  

  209. }  

  210.  

  211. public bomb_defused(defuser) {  

  212.     new DefName[32]  

  213.     new randem = random_num(0,2)  

  214.      

  215.     if(!get_pcvar_num(g_Cvar))  

  216.         return PLUGIN_CONTINUE  

  217.          

  218.     remove_task(0,0)  

  219.      

  220.     get_user_name(defuser, DefName, 31)  

  221.      

  222.     set_dhudmessage( 219, 219, 112, 0.35, 0.03, 0, 6.0, 3.0, 0.1, 1.5 )

  223.     show_dhudmessage(defuser, "Bomba Hatastalanitva! Szep Munka %s", DefName)  

  224.      

  225.     switch(randem)  

  226.   {  

  227.     case 0: client_cmd(0,"spk radio/bot/good_one_sir2.wav")  

  228.     case 1: client_cmd(0,"spk radio/bot/bombdef.wav")  

  229.   }  

  230.     return PLUGIN_HANDLED  

  231. }  

  232.  

  233.  

  234. public RoundEnd()  

  235. {  

  236.     remove_task(0,0)  

  237. }  

  238.  

  239.  

  240. public logevent_round_star()  

  241. {  

  242.     remove_task(0,0)  

  243. }  

  244.  

Szerző:  VirTuaL ~` [2012.07.13. 13:42 ]
Hozzászólás témája:  Re: C4Plugin run time error

Kód:
  1. register_logevent("logevent_round_start", 2, "1=Round_Start")

Ezt a sort vedd ki.

Szerző:  oroszrulett [2012.07.14. 20:39 ]
Hozzászólás témája:  Re: C4Plugin run time error

Ha lehookolsz egy eseményt, akkor írd is meg a függvényét.

Oldal: 1 / 1 Minden időpont UTC+02:00 időzóna szerinti
Powered by phpBB® Forum Software © phpBB Limited
https://www.phpbb.com/